This paper illustrates the tradition method of producing chitosan fiber, summarizes the research situation that the way is used to produce chitosan fiber at home and abroad, analyzes the key problems existed in the tradition production of chitosan fiber including low production efficiency, high cost of production and demanding improvement of chitosan fiber performance. In order to resolve these problems, the key technology of producing chitosan is researched in this article.The key technology research of producing chitosan reduces the cost of production immensely, improves the use performance of chitosan fiber as well as increases the production efficiency and harvest.The key technology of chitosan spinning solution is researched first. The factors affecting the stationary of chitosan spinning solution is analyzed through tests. The Analysis results offer the theoretical guidance for the preparation and using of chitosan spinning solution. Therefore the spinning property of spinning solution is advanced.The key technology of high active dissolving the chitosan is researched. This article improves the dissolve equipment, simulates the preparing of spinning solvent in use of computational fluid dynamics software. The reasonable effective preparing equipment is designed based on the comparation of preparation result. This method reduces the test cost as well as decides the using range of blender designed. This way resolves the dissolve problems of chitosan including low dissolve efficiency, asymmetry dissolve and easy to emerge micelle. The preparing efficiency and dissolving result is improved.This article designs the continuous spinning technology that is low production cost and high producing efficiency. The continuous producing is achieved and the basis of chitosan fiber filament is established. This method resolves the problems existed in use of traditional spinning method, such as high producing price, complicated producing process and time-consuming. At the same time, this article analyzes the chitosan fiber performance including the formation of fiber, the electrical conductivity of fiber and the anti-bacterium of fiber produced in new spinning method. The analyzed result is used to guild the producing and application of chitosan fiber.
